    I'd been wanting to rescreen the pool cage and have a bit of renovation done on it, it was showing…read moreit's age a bit. Then in October, Hurricane Milton decided to take down one of our neighbors tall pines which slammed right through the pool enclosure and into our pool. Half of the aluminum and screens were demolished. It took two+ months for our insurance company to tell us that they wouldn't replace it, and to repair it would cost less than the deductible. So we were two months behind everyone else who was looking to repair from the hurricane. We got a lot of quotes. Some companies took a month to get us a quote. Almost no companies would quote us on repair, only replace. Structural integrity and all that. Of all the companies we got estimates from, ASAP was the best with price and communication. It was an easy choice. It took a few weeks to get the project started, but they had told us that would be the case. They pulled the permits and once they got started, it was a matter of days, and ...perfect new pool enclosure. The communication was great the whole process and we are happy to have it completed.
